<aside> 1️⃣
(0-1 Year of Training)
Muscle gain per month: 0.9–1.2 kg
Muscle gain per year: 8–12 kg
Fastest gains happen in the first year due to "newbie gains."
Can build muscle and lose fat at the same time, especially if overweight. </aside>
<aside> 2️⃣
(1-3 Years of Training)
Muscle gain per month: 0.5–0.9 kg
Muscle gain per year: 4–8 kg
Gains slow down as the body adapts.
Strength training and diet must be more precise. </aside>
<aside> 3️⃣
(3+ Years of Training)
Muscle gain per month: 0.2–0.5 kg
Muscle gain per year: 2–4 kg
Gains are much slower and require perfect training, diet, and recovery. </aside>
